Разница между Hibernate Cascade и обратными свойствами

Возможный дубликат:
В чем разница между каскадом и инверсией в спящем режиме, какая от них польза?

В чем разница между Hibernate Cascade и обратными свойствами?


person Kaushik Lele    schedule 28.01.2012    source источник
comment
был задан вопрос @ stackoverflow ссылка также проверьте ссылка2   -  person baba.kabira    schedule 28.01.2012
comment
@gbagga Я разместил свой ответ на ссылку stackoverflow. Проверьте и дайте мне знать.   -  person Kaushik Lele    schedule 28.01.2012


Ответы (1)


Каскад

У человека есть адрес. Без каскада вам нужно сохранить каждый из них отдельно. При каскадном сохранении происходит автоматически. В общем случае он указывает, какие операции (сохранение, удаление и т. д.) следует каскадировать на дочерние объекты.

Инверсия

Он идентифицирует владельца отношения. Обычно он используется для оптимизации сгенерированного sql, т. е. влияет на генерацию запроса.

Рекомендуемое чтение: http://www.mkyong.com/hibernate/разные-между-каскадом-и-инверсией/

person Aravind Yarram    schedule 28.01.2012
comment
@KaushikLele кажется, что вы новичок в SO. Вам нужно принять ответы, чтобы больше людей могли ответить на ваши последующие вопросы. Я не прошу вас принять мой ответ, но подождите и посмотрите другие ответы, а затем выберите наиболее подходящий в качестве ответа. - person Aravind Yarram; 28.01.2012
comment
@gbagga Я разместил свой ответ на ссылку stackoverflow. Проверьте и дайте мне знать - person Kaushik Lele; 28.01.2012
comment
@KaushikLele, значит, вы задали тот же вопрос, на который не знали ответа, а затем ответили на него в исходном вопросе? - person Aravind Yarram; 28.01.2012
comment
@gbagga на самом деле я читал ответы на этот вопрос в нескольких местах, но не думал, что ясно понял концепцию. Так я делал своими руками на примере. Как только я увидел реальную разницу, я решил поделиться этим с другими. - person Kaushik Lele; 28.01.2012